How do you write a book report for 8th grade?
Always include the following elements in any book report:
- the type of book report you are writing.
- the title of the book.
- the author of the book.
- the time when the story takes place.
- the location where the story takes place.
- the names and a brief description of each of the characters you will be discussing.

How should a 8th grader write a book review?
What To Do
- The book’s title and author.
- A brief summary of the plot that doesn’t give away too much.
- Comments on the book’s strengths and weaknesses.
- The reviewer’s personal response to the book with specific examples to support praise or criticism.
What makes a good book review?
The most important element of a review is that it is a commentary, not merely a summary. In either case, reviews need to be succinct. While they vary in tone, subject, and style, they share some common features: First, a review gives the reader a concise summary of the content.

What should be included in a book report?
A book report is a way to tell others about a book you have read. A good book report should include the book’s author, title, characters, setting, and plot, as well as a personal endorsement, which is your opinion of the book.
What questions do you ask in a book report?
Here are some sample questions you can include on a book report assignment:
- What is the main conflict of the story?
- What is the setting of the story?
- What is the ‘inciting’ incident?
- Describe the main character of the story.
- Describe one minor character from the story.
- Who is the antagonist (villain) of the story?
